Gov Ododo applauds President Tinubu for appointing Kogi indigenes to key positions

Kogi State Government, has expressed heartfelt appreciation to President Bola Ahmed Tinubu for appointing several illustrious sons and daughters of the state into key positions at the federal level.

He described the gesture as a testament to the President’s commitment to inclusive governance and national development.

In a statement signed by the State Commissioner for Information and Communications, Hon. Kingsley Fanwo, the state’s Chief Servant, His Excellency Alhaji Ahmed Usman Ododo, extended gratitude to the President for what he called a “demonstration of confidence in the capacity, competence, and character” of Kogi’s indigenes.

“These appointments are a reflection of Mr. President’s unwavering belief in the diversity of our nation and the value that each state brings to the table,” the statement read. “We are proud that Kogi indigenes have once again been found worthy to serve the nation at the highest levels.”

The government described the appointments as a clarion call to the new appointees to be worthy ambassadors of Kogi State, urging them to bring to bear the excellence and integrity that define the state’s identity.

“Your elevation is not just an honour but a responsibility to deliver results, to uphold the ideals of service, and to reflect the values we hold dear in Kogi State,” the government charged the new appointees.

Fanwo noted that Kogi State remains committed to partnering with the Federal Government to ensure sustained progress and development, both within the state and across the nation.

“We remain resolute in our support for Mr. President and will continue to work hand-in-hand with his administration in building a Nigeria that works for all,” the statement added.

The Kogi State Government sent a message of congratulations to the appointees, charging them to be good Ambassadors of the Confluence State.
